Advantages of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ium doors and windows provide a myriad of advantages over traditional products such as wood and PVC. Here are some of the essential benefits:
1. ToughnessWeather Resistance: Aluminium is resistant to the elements, including rain, sun, and wind, making it less susceptible to warping or decaying compared to wood.Long Lifespan: With appropriate upkeep, aluminium items can last for decades without the requirement for substantial repair work or replacement.2. Aesthetic AppealStreamlined Design: Aluminium doors and windows have a modern-day look and can match different architectural designs, enhancing the overall appeal of a property.Color Options: They are offered in a large range of colours and surfaces, enabling homeowners to customize their look quickly.3. Energy EfficiencyThermal Break Technology: Modern aluminium windows and doors frequently feature thermal breaks, which assist in decreasing heat transfer and enhancing energy performance.Insulation: Options are offered to integrate double or triple glazing, further enhancing insulation properties.4. Low MaintenanceEasy to Clean: Aluminium surface areas can be quickly wiped down to keep them looking as great as new. Aluminium doors and windows been available in different designs and performance, each suited to various requirements and preferences. The following are some common types:

While aluminium doors and windows are low-maintenance, a few simple practices can help extend their life-span and keep them looking new. Here's an upkeep list:
Maintenance Checklist
Routine Cleaning:
Use moderate cleaning agent and water to clean the frames and glass.Guarantee that dirt and debris are routinely removed from rail tracks and hinges.
Check Seals:
Check the seals and gaskets each year for wear and tear.Replace any damaged seals to keep energy efficiency.
Lubricate Moving Parts:
Lubricate hinges, locks, and rollers to make sure smooth operation and prevent rust.
Check for Corrosion:
Look for any indications of corrosion, especially in seaside areas, and address any problems immediately.
Expert Servicing:

Aluminium is a recyclable material, making it an eco-friendly choice. When properly recycled, it keeps its properties indefinitely without considerable destruction. The production of aluminium has a lower ecological effect when compared to other products, particularly when sourced from recycled sources.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are aluminium windows and doors more expensive than wood?
While the initial expense of aluminium alternatives may be higher, their resilience and low upkeep can lead to cost savings in the long run.
2. Can aluminium windows and doors be painted?
Yes, aluminium can be painted, however it's advisable to use an unique exterior-grade paint created for metal surface areas.
3. How do aluminium windows compare to PVC windows in terms of energy performance?
Both aluminium and PVC windows can be energy effective, but aluminium windows with thermal breaks offer exceptional insulation compared to standard PVC options.
4. Are aluminium windows and doors prone to condensation?
While aluminium can experience condensation, using thermal breaks and double glazing considerably lowers the threat.
